ERRATA CORRIGE

Andrea Savarino   (2010-03-29 13:24)  ISS email

I am sorry I noticed the following errors in the published version of the manuscript:

Additional file 1: Please erase from caption: “the highly conserved catalytic residues D64, D116 and E152 (presented in yellow) and”.

Abstract: “Tenofovir disoproxil fumarate” should read, simply, "tenofovir".

Background, fourth paragraph: Again, please do not consider “disoproxil fumarate”.

Caption of Figure 2: Sixth line: Please do not consider “pro-drug”. Seventh line:“Tenofovir disoproxil fumarate” should read, simply, "tenofovir".

Methods section "Nonhuman primate studies": “50 mg/kg/BID or 100 mg/kg/BID” Please do not consider “/kg/” thus it should read as: “50 mg BID or 100 mg BID”.
